About Somerset County Public Schools

Somerset County Public Schools is a Westover, Maryland school district serving 7 schools.The district educates 2,894 students with a student-teacher ratio of 11.5:1. District-level spending was $24,750 per student in fiscal year 2023 (NCES F-33).

With an average rating of 6.5/10, Somerset County Public Schools demonstrates solid academic performance.

The highest-rated school in the district is Greenwood Elementary School, which has a composite score of 8.7/10.

In standardized testing, Somerset County Public Schools students show an average math proficiency of 41.5% and ELA proficiency of 50.5%.

The district includes 4 elementary schools, 1 middle school, and 2 high schools.
